What does a Korean father look like? Strict, cold and focused (集中)only on his job. Well, yes, this is the popular image (形象) of Korean fathers. However, this image does not tell the whole story. Across the country, more and more fathers are looking for the answer to the question: what does it mean to be a good father today? And they choose to attend Father School.

Set up in 1995, Father School began in Seoul. It was to help Korean men show love to their families. Most of the students are from 30 to 70 years old. They are asked to write letters to their kids as homework and to practice saying “I love you” to all family members.

Like many students in Father School, Edmond Rhim never wanted to come. “I’m not a bad father,” he said. “But it was just difficult for me to communicate with my two teenage kids.” He began to show up in class, and things got better. When he graduated from the school among 70 other men, he no longer felt awkward (尴尬的) when hugging his wife and kids.

Ye Xiaogang is known as one of the most famous modern Chinese composers.

He learned to play the piano at the age of four.His father was a composer who wrote a lot of music for films.But when his father was sent to a farm to work.Ye was only 11 at that time.

Ye had to work on another farm for a year before entering a factory.He worked in the factory for six years until he was 22.

The workers in the factory were friendly and helped him a lot,but he could not play the piano any more.No matter(不论)how hard he worked on the farm or in the factory,he never left music.He just waited for chances.He dreamed of becoming a pianist.

When Ye could play the piano again.he practiced hard every day in order to go to the Central Conservatory of Music in 1978.but the school would not recruit(招收)piano students that year.In the end.Ye chose composition(作曲)as his major(专业).although he was not familiar with it.

In 1980.he studied at Cambridge University.Then he went to a famous school of music in the US in 1987 to take more courses.

As a famous composer in China.Ye worked for many organizations.

He wrote many symphonies(交响乐).He also wrote film and TV music.which traditional composers hardly ever worked on.

William Shakespeare was a writer of plays and poems. Some of his most famous plays are Hamlet, Romeo and Juliet, Macbeth. He wrote thirty-seven plays in all. They are still popular today.

He was born in England. At school he liked watching plays. He decided to be an actor when he finished school at the age of fourteen. In 1582,he married a farmer’s daughter. She was eight years older than he was. Their first child was a daughter. Later they had twins. In 1585,Shakespeare left his hometown, Stratford-upon-Avon. His wife and children stayed behind. No one knows why he left or what he did between 1585 and 1592.

At twenty-eight, he moved to London and joined a theatre company which opened the Globe Theatre in 1599.He became an actor, and he also wrote plays. He usually acted in his own plays. He made almost no money from his writing. But he made a lot of money from acting. With the money he bought a large house in his hometown.

At the age of forty-nine, Shakespeare retired(退休)and went to live in Stratford-upon-Avon. He died at the age of fifty-two in 1616. He left his money to his family. He left the genius(天才)to the world. You still see his plays in English and in many other languages. He is one of the most famous writers in the world.

Camels(骆驼) are amazing animals. They aren’t the most beautiful animals in the world. But they are certainly the most useful animals in the hot areas such as North Africa and the Middle East. They usually help people carry things. Now let’s learn more about camels.

There are two kinds of camels on the Earth. They are Arabian (阿拉伯的) camels and Asian camels. Arabian camels are dromedaries (单峰骆驼), but Asian camels are bactrians (双峰骆驼). An adult camel is about 2 meters tall and weighs about 500 kilograms. Its legs are long. And its feet are big and soft. Most of the camels can live for about 40 years, but they usually stop working when they are about 25.

Camels live alone in the desert (沙漠). They aren’t afraid of the hot and cold weather. They mainly eat grass, leaves and bushes. They can walk for more than 600 kilometers without drinking. They only need to drink water every six or eight days. But when there is water, they can drink up to 90 liters ( 升). Camels walk slowly. They don’t like running because it’s too hot. But if they need, they can run at 20 kilometers an hour.

Jilin is a good place. It is in the north-east of China. On the north of it is Heilongjiang, the south is Liaoning, the west is Inner Mongolia and the east is North Korea(朝鲜).

It has a long and snowy winter. Usually the winter here starts from October and lasts(持续) for six months. Every year people come here for the Ice Lantern Festival and the winter sports.

Changbai Shan is the first mountain in the north-east of China. There is a lot of snow on the main mountain-"Baitou Shan" all the year, so it is named "Changbai Shan". It has great forests on it. There are tigers, deer, black bears and many other animals in the forests and there are a lot of hot springs (泉) and more than l,500 kinds of plants. On the very top of the mountain is Tianchi. If you come to the lake, you might see the monster(水怪) in it.There is also a great waterfall(瀑布) where the Songhua River comes from.

Another place in Jilin is Xianghai in Tongyu County(县). There are more than 100 pieces of wetlands here. And they are of different sizes. There are 170 kinds of birds, some fish that we can't often see and over 250 different herbal(草药) plants and trees here.
